The National Nutrition Council LUPang Ilocos conducted a five-day live in training on Nutrition Program Management last September 30 to October 4, 2013 at the Hotel Ariana, Bauang, La Union. This training aims to enhance the capacity of local nutrition workers particularly on managing nutrition programs at the local level. It is intended to build capacities of local implementers particularly in identifying ways of improving local Nutrition Program Management especially in the development and implementation of responsive and effective nutrition plans.
Newly-designated Nutrition Action Officers and areas with no Local Nutrition Action Plans were trained. A total of 25 participants attended the training coming from the different municipalities and cities of the region. They were very thankful that a training like this was sponsored by the National Nutrition Council.
Ms. Mency V. Tolentino, MNAO of Bacarra, Ilocos Norte, Ms. Elma S. Irapta, PNAO of Ilcocos Norte, Ms. Remelina M. Maglaya, PNAO of La Union, Ms. Rosalina Estillore, DNPC of La Union and Ms. Analiza S. Miranda, DNPC of Pangasinan served as trainor-facilitators.
The training consisted of a variety of learning methods like lecture-discussions, role-plays, practice sessions and group activities. During the preparation of re-entry plans, PNAO Irapta emphasized on the need to draft the three-year Local Nutrition Action Plan to synchronize with the formulation of the Local Development Plan (LDP).
OIC- NPC Rose Lulu P. Pagaduan commended everybody for their presence ad active participation during the training. Finally, she emphasized on the actions to be taken for the efficient and effective management of their local nutrition program
